| def write_depends(self): |
| # |
| # Find all the available headers and what they depend upon. the |
| # include_deps is a dictionary mapping a short header name to a tuple |
| # of the full path to the header and a dictionary of dependent header |
| # names (short) mapping to None. |
| # |
| # Example: |
| # { 'short.h' : ('/path/to/short.h', |
| # { 'other.h' : None, 'foo.h' : None }) } |
| # |
| # Note that this structure does not allow for similarly named headers |
| # in per-project directories. SVN doesn't have this at this time, so |
| # this structure works quite fine. (the alternative would be to use |
| # the full pathname for the key, but that is actually a bit harder to |
| # work with since we only see short names when scanning, and keeping |
| # a second variable around for mapping the short to long names is more |
| # than I cared to do right now) |
| # |
| include_deps = gen_base._create_include_deps(self.includes) |
| for d in self.target_dirs.keys(): |
| hdrs = glob.glob(os.path.join(d, '*.h')) |
| if hdrs: |
| more_deps = gen_base._create_include_deps(hdrs, include_deps) |
| include_deps.update(more_deps) |
| |
| for src, objname in self.file_deps: |
| hdrs = [ ] |
| for short in gen_base._find_includes(src, include_deps): |
| hdrs.append(include_deps[short][0]) |
| self.ofile.write('%s: %s %s\n' % (objname, src, string.join(hdrs))) |
